Pytorch深度学习框架专栏

Pytorch是一个由facebook团队开发的基于python的优秀的神经网络框架,其前身为torch(采用lua语言开发)。不同于TensorFlow,Pytorch构造神经网络采用动态构造的方法,可以实时地搭建神经网络并直接运行,大部分的网络结构测试中,其运行效率要高于我们平常所使用的TensorFlow。目前在学术界Pytorch有赶超TensorFlow的趋势。

Pytorch目前最新版为1.7.1,release信息在这里。新版本有对旧版本依然很好的兼容性。新版本的前端操作方式基本不变,增加了对生产部署环境的支持,主要的更新点有三:


《Pytorch深度学习框架专栏》
From pytorch.org

说明

博主现在的主力深度学习框架即为Pytorch,在使用过TensorFlow以及Keras后再接触Pytorch就会发现其优雅而又不失效率的特性。但因为Pytorch相比较于TensorFlow是新生“产物”,其代码有略微的不稳定性和功能上的一些小Bug,导致一些新手可能会陷入一些疑惑。因此,我想通过这个页面将我对Pytorch的一些心得一些感悟一些教程分享给大家,和大家共勉。另外基于Pytorch的fastai库的1.0版本也发布了,对于fastai库也会进行相应的讲解。

本页面会一直进行更新,最晚每周一次(打脸了),所有汇总的文章都来源于Oldpan博客,这里主要是整理和汇总方便大家查阅。

Pytorch版本更新信息:

Pytorch环境安装:

Pytorch入门

Pytorch进阶

   概念:

   项目:

如果有什么问题或者疑问欢迎在此页面留言。
也可以通过关注Oldpan博客公众号和我一起交流,非常欢迎~

《Pytorch深度学习框架专栏》

  1. J
    Jiang Yan说道:

    你好,请问Deep-Painterly-Harmonization-Pytorch这个项目的代码可以work了吗?

    1. O
      Oldpan说道:

      能跑,因为没优化..需要的显存11G多一点,还没整理代码比较乱,如果确实需要跑可以单独联系我

发表评论

邮箱地址不会被公开。 必填项已用*标注

评论审核已启用。您的评论可能需要一段时间后才能被显示。